Market Opportunity
Automated exception management for retail returns and pickups targets a $3.6B = 600,000 retail stores globally x $600 ACV (software + transaction fees) - broad retail returns management market. total addressable market with low saturation and a year-over-year growth rate of 10-18% - returns and reverse logistics growth driven by e-commerce and same-day delivery expectations.
Key trends driving demand: Returns growth -- e-commerce and large-item home delivery increases frequency and cost of returns, raising demand for automation; API-enabled payments -- Stripe and PayPal dispute APIs enable automated, auditable charge and refund workflows; On-demand pickups -- gig couriers and micro-fulfillment give cheaper last-mile pickup options for bulky items; Resale/refurb channels -- marketplaces for open-box and refurbished goods improve recovery rates for returned large items.
Key competitors include Returnly, Narvar, Happy Returns (PayPal), Manual workarounds and payment processor dispute handling.
